New heart pump could make risky procedures safer
NCT ID NCT07296744
First seen Jan 07, 2026 · Last updated May 13, 2026 · Updated 27 times
Summary
This study compares a new temporary heart pump, the Supira System, to an existing pump (Impella) in 358 people undergoing high-risk heart procedures. The goal is to see if the new pump reduces complications like death, heart attack, stroke, or kidney injury. Participants must be stable enough for elective or urgent procedures, but not in shock.
